🎨 Why are the designs so minimal? Other resources have more colour and detail.
Deliberately. Many autistic children experience visual overwhelm from busy, colourful graphics. The minimal design reduces sensory load, making it easier for your child to focus on and process the meaning of each card. Multiple occupational therapists and ABA practitioners contributed feedback on the visual design specifically for this reason.

📱 Can these be used alongside an AAC device?
Yes. The emotion cards and communication boards are designed to complement AAC use — not replace it. Many families print and laminate the cards so their child has a physical backup when technology is not available, or for use in situations where pulling out a device is not practical (bath time, bedtime, school hallways).
